JagdPanther at Duxford
The AFV ASSOCIATION was formed in 1964 to support the thoughts and research of all those interested in Armored Fighting Vehicles and related topics, such as AFV drawings. The emphasis has always been on sharing information and communicating with other members of similar interests; e.g. German armor, Japanese AFVs, or whatever.

Post subject: JagdPanther at Duxford

The Jagdpanther that was for many years, in the IWM's main building in London, has been relocated to Duxford.
Much harder to see it now, no more peering into the shell holes in its rear!

Post subject: Re: JagdPanther at Duxford

- Pzkpfw-e
I can't remember. I saw it in London, many years ago and I think the engine as visible through the holes made by the Cromwell that knocked it out.


Three of the holes enter the fighting compartment, which is well lit from the cutaway armor on the other side. ISTR a single hole at the far right rear of the vehicle that didn't reveal much with available light (it was back in the shadows of the 2nd floor walkway as well). Maybe if someone got a flash in there. I did manage a flash through a fighting compartment hole, so I reckon that found the view in the rear to be not worth it (meaning, nothing of interest was visible from outside).
